This book contains Python programs and more than illustrations useful both to students of science of the first university courses, as well as high school students and teachers. All the programs and graphics of the book have been developed using free software, which you can obtain free and legally on the internet, so it is not necessary to buy any software. Python is currently the most popular language for teaching introductory computer science courses at top-ranked U. You can freely write Python programs whether you are a Windows user or whether you prefer Mac or Linux. A free pdf excerpt is available at our website www. The buyers of the book can also download the code of the Python programs. The book consists of a detailed introduction to Python, followed by ten chapters of mathematics with its corresponding Python programs, results and graphs.
High school algebra and a reasonable aptitude for mathematics Students without prior programming background will find there is a steep learning curve and may have to put in more than the estimated time effort 6 00x will be using the Python programming language, version 3 5. Programming and Mathematical Thinking. Mathematics for the Digital Age and Programming in Python. The Python programming language Python is easy to learn, simple to use, and enormously powerful It has facilities and features for performing tasks of many kinds You can do art or engineering in Python, surf the web or calculate your taxes, write words or write music, make a movie or make the next billion-dollar Internet start-up 1. Exploring Mathematics with Matplotlib and Python.
